* {
  margin: 0;
  padding: 0;
  box-sizing: border-box;
}

body {
  /*background-image: url('fondo.jpg');*/
}

.form-register {
  /*width: 600px;*/
  width: 100%;
  height: 530px;
  /*border: 10px solid #003459;*/
  margin-border: 30px;
  padding-top: 60px;
  border-radius: 30px;
  margin: 20px;
  padding: 10px;
  background: #FAFAFA;
  padding: 30px;
  margin: auto;
  margin-top: 70px;
  border-radius: 0px;
  font-family: 'calibri';
  color: white;
  text-align: left;
  /*background-image: url('fondoformulario.png');*/
 /*box-line: 7px 13px 37px #000;*/
}

.form-register h3 {
  font-size: 22px;
  margin-bottom: 40px;
  text-align: left;


}

.controls {
  width: 100%;
  margin: 16px 0;
  background: #ccc;
  padding: 10px;
  /*border-radius: 4px;*/
  margin-bottom: 16px;
  border: 1px solid #ccc;
  font-family: 'calibri';
  font-size: 18px;
  color: #003459;
  text-align: left;
}

.form-register textarea {
  width: 100%;
  margin: 16px 0;
  background: #ccc;
  padding: 10px;
  /*border-radius: 4px;*/
  margin-bottom: 16px;
  border: 1px solid #ccc;
  font-family: 'calibri';
  font-size: 18px;
  color: #003459;
  text-align: left;
  height: 10vh;
}


input::placeholder {
  color: #003459;
  font-size: 1.2em;
  font-style: bold;
}

textarea::placeholder {
  color: #003459;
  font-size: 1.2em;
  font-style: bolder;
}


.form-register p {
	/*margin-right: 125px;*/
  /*text-align: right;*/
  font-size: 18px;
  line-height: 20px;
  text-align: left;
}

.form-register a {
  color: white;
  text-decoration: none;
  text-align: left;
}

.form-register a:hover {
  color: white;
  /*text-decoration: underline;*/
}

.form-register .botons {
  width: 30%;
  /*height: 120px;*/
  background: #003459;
  border: none;
  padding: 12px;
  color: white;
  margin: 16px 0;
  font-size: 16px;
}

.caja{
	margin-top: 40px;
	height: 700px;border: 8px solid #003459;
	-moz-border-radius: 7px;
	-webkit-border-radius: 15px;
	padding: 10px;
	text-align: left;
}



@media (min-width: 768px) {
    .caja {
        width: 480px;
    }
}